New opportunity exists for a Family Solicitor to join this regional firm. You will join a busy department and undertake a privately funded caseload encompassing:
- Divorce and separation
- Financial settlements
- Dissolution of civil partnerships
- Pre and post nuptial agreements
- Cohabitation agreements
- Children matters
- Domestic abuse / injunctions
This role provides an excellent opportunity to develop your knowledge and expertise, working on a caseload of diverse, high-quality work alongside experienced lawyers. You will also be encouraged to develop your caseload and contacts by taking part in networking and business development activities as required.
